    BNSF Railway (reporting mark BNSF) is the largest freight railroad in the United States. One of six North American Class I railroads, BNSF has 36,000 employees, 33,400 miles (53,800 km) of track in 28 states, and over 8,000 locomotives.

The Georgia Southern and Florida Railway ( reporting mark GSF ), also known as the Suwanee River Route from its crossing of the Suwanee River, was founded in 1885 as the Georgia Southern and Florida Railroad and began operations between Macon, GA and Valdosta, GA in 1889, extending to Palatka, FL in 1890.   7. City of Moultrie Train. The train near Downtown Moultrie used to travel the Georgia Northern Railway in the 1900s. The 105 railroad engine is the perfect representation of how Colquitt County began. Before trains came to town, there was no fast way to travel or move timber. Trains were a game-changer, fostering rapid growth in our area.
